Description

Lawson banoffee pie delivers a divine British dessert where creamy banana, rich caramel, and smooth whipped cream dance together on a crisp biscuit base. Sweet indulgence awaits you in each delectable slice of this classic comfort treat.


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ients:

  • 3 ripe bananas
  • 1 can (397 grams / 14 ounces) condensed milk
  • 300 milliliters (10.1 fluid ounces) heavy cream

Crust Ingredients:

  • 250 grams (8.8 ounces) digestive biscuits
  • 150 grams (5.3 ounces) unsalted butter, melted

Garnish Ingredients:

  • Dark chocolate (for topping)

Instructions

  1. Transform graham crackers into fine crumbs by pulsing in a food processor, then blend thoroughly with melted butter until mixture resembles wet sand.
  2. Press the crumb mixture firmly and evenly into a 9-inch pie dish, creating a compact base. Refrigerate for 30 minutes to set and firm up the crust.
  3. Submerge an unopened condensed milk can completely in water, ensuring it’s covered by at least 2 inches. Gently simmer on low heat for 2.5 hours, monitoring water level and replenishing as needed.
  4. Remove the can carefully and allow it to cool completely at room temperature for approximately 1 hour before opening, creating a rich, golden caramel.
  5. Once chilled, carefully spread the transformed condensed milk caramel in an even layer across the prepared crust.
  6. Peel ripe bananas and slice diagonally into uniform thin rounds, arranging them meticulously over the caramel layer to cover completely.
  7. Whip heavy cream using an electric mixer until soft, billowy peaks form, being careful not to overbeat.
  8. Gently spread the whipped cream across the banana layer, creating elegant swirls and peaks.
  9. Delicately grate dark chocolate over the cream surface using a microplane for a delicate, elegant finish.
  10. Refrigerate the pie for a minimum of 4 hours to allow flavors to meld and texture to set perfectly.

Notes

  • Caramelize condensed milk carefully by ensuring the can is fully submerged in water to prevent explosions, and use a timer to achieve the perfect golden-brown color.
  • Create a gluten-free version by substituting regular biscuits with gluten-free alternatives like almond or coconut flour-based cookies.
  • Prevent banana browning by tossing sliced bananas in a bit of lemon juice before layering, which adds a subtle brightness and keeps them looking fresh.
  • Enhance flavor complexity by adding a sprinkle of sea salt over the caramel layer or using dark chocolate shavings for a more sophisticated finish.
